import java.io.*;
import java.nio.file.*;
import java.nio.charset.StandardCharsets;
import java.security.MessageDigest;
import java.security.NoSuchAlgorithmException;
public class MyFileWriter {
public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Exception {
System.out.println(hashfile("Cooper"));
String data = "Hello, World!";
String fileName1 = "example.txt";
String fileName2 = "example2.txt";
String fileName3 = "example3.txt";
String fileName4 = "example4.txt";
String fileName5 = "example5.txt";
// 1. Using FileWriter
try (FileWriter writer = new FileWriter(fileName1)) {
writer.write(data);
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
// 2. Using BufferedWriter
try (BufferedWriter bufferedWriter = new BufferedWriter(new FileWriter(fileName2))) {
bufferedWriter.write(data);
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
// 3. Using FileOutputStream
try (FileOutputStream outputStream = new FileOutputStream(fileName3)) {
outputStream.write(data.getBytes());
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
// 4. Using BufferedOutputStream
try (BufferedOutputStream bufferedOutputStream =
new BufferedOutputStream(new FileOutputStream(fileName4))) {
bufferedOutputStream.write(data.getBytes());
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
// 5. Using Files (java.nio.file)
try {
Files.write(Paths.get(fileName5), data.getBytes(StandardCharsets.UTF_8));
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}

testPrintFileSize();
}
private static void printFileSize(String... fileNames) {
long totalSize = 0;
for (String fileName : fileNames) {
File file = new File(fileName);
if (file.exists()) {
totalSize += file.length();
}
}
System.out.println("Total size of all files: " + totalSize + " bytes");
}
private static void testPrintFileSize() {
File file1 = new File("file1.txt");
try {
Files.write(Paths.get("file1.txt"),
"fortnitebattlepass".getBytes(StandardCharsets.UTF_8));
} catch (Exception e) {
// TODO: handle exception
}
printFileSize("file1.txt", ".hiddenfile.txt", ".secretfolder/passwordfile.txt");
}
/**
* Reads a text file and returns its contents as a string.
*
* @param filePath the path to the file
* @return the contents of the file as a string
* @throws IOException if an I/O error occurs
*/
public static String stringify(String filePath) throws IOException {
String string = Files.readString(Paths.get(filePath));
return string;
}
public static String hashfile(String input) throws IOException {
try {
File file = new File(input);
FileReader reader = new FileReader(file);
StringBuilder string = new StringBuilder();
while (reader.ready()) {
string.append((char) reader.read());
}
reader.close();
String stringFile = string.toString();
// Create a MessageDigest instance for SHA-256
MessageDigest digest = MessageDigest.getInstance("SHA-256");
// Perform the hash computation
byte[] encodedhash = digest.digest(stringFile.getBytes());
// Convert byte array into a hexadecimal string
StringBuilder hexString = new StringBuilder();
for (byte b : encodedhash) {
String hex = Integer.toHexString(0xff & b);
if (hex.length() == 1) {
hexString.append('0');
}
hexString.append(hex);
}
return hexString.toString();
} cat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e) {
throw new RuntimeException(e);
}
}
}
